Not exactly the product I wanted, price and quality don't match.

It's inexpensive and has a passable modern appearance, but I passed on it and instead put that money into a better purchase. Benefits include: The diminutive form is quite charming. It works great both as a personal computer at home or in a medium-sized gaming group. Because of the compact size of the case itself, you can assemble it relatively quickly, accurately, and without any needless hemorrhoids if you approach it in the right way throughout the process of cable management. Contrast several: The front plastic panel is constructed of cheap plastic, as it should be for all budget cases, and the metal is at the level of foil. The standard of execution is generally quite poor. When I first saw the window, I assumed it was made of glass, but alas, it turns out to be scratchable plexiglass. After assembly, this was the first time I can recall hearing anything that sounded like a Soviet transformer, and it was caused by the plexiglass vibrating from the fans. I had to stop the window from shaking by stuffing it full of junk. The top's perforation led me to believe that it was designed to accommodate one 120-volt fan, but because there are no mounting holes in that area, I'm not sure what purpose it serves.
